The short-run in production is the time period when
- A. techniques of production can easily be changed
- B. all factors of production are variable
- C. at least a factor is fixed while others are variableCorrect
- D. variable factors cannot be changed
Explanation
The short-run is defined as a period of time in which at least one factor of production is fixed while other factors are variable.
